Description
The MSA-2111 is a low cost silicon bipolar Monolithic Mi-
crowave Integrated Circuit (MMIC) housed in a surface
mount plastic SOT-143 package. This MMIC is designed
for use as a general purpose 50 Ω gain block. Typical ap-
plications include narrow and broad band IF and RF am-
plifiers in commercial and industrial applications.
